Job description

Role overview

The Scenario Designing Specialist will lead work related to identifying, categorizing, designing, and building scenarios for assessment. The position also supports benchmarking activities for scenario development and helps drive the implementation of recommended improvements.

This role is responsible for putting the scenario design and development governance framework into practice, ensuring tasks are carried out in line with that framework, and recommending updates or refinements to management when needed.

The specialist will also help prepare responses to requests received by the organization, working with the modeling team to provide results across modeled scenarios.

Key responsibilities

  • Help develop and maintain governance frameworks for scenario design and development, while proposing practical enhancements and updates as needed. Ensure the framework aligns with applicable local, federal, regional, and global requirements.
  • Using entered model inputs, assist the modeling team with regular updates to energy, water, and wider energy-related models.
  • Work with the modeling team to create and maintain forms and models for energy, water, and electricity data entry, including updated information gathered from key stakeholders and relevant local, federal, regional, and global sources.
  • Support stakeholder management activities connected to scenario design and development, and assist in the final preparation of modeled data.
  • Conduct in-depth research and coordinate with different institutions to better understand scenario development approaches and related issues, comparing them with other frameworks for benchmarking and performance measurement.

Qualifications

A bachelor’s degree in Energy Engineering, Data Management, or a related discipline is required.

Experience

Applicants should have 3 to 5 years of experience in a relevant area such as scenario building, scenario design, data management, or energy modeling.
